Manasiloru Manimuthu ({{Translation|A bell pearl in mind}}) is a 1986 Indian Malayalam-language drama film directed by J. Sasikumar and written by S. L. Puram Sadanandan from a story by Sasikumar, produced by Royal Achankunju. The film stars Mohanlal, Suresh Gopi, Urvashi and Sankaradi. The narrative centers around Mohan (portrayed by Mohanlal), a wealthy individual known for his flawed personality. He falls in love with a woman (played by Urvashi), who ultimately marries another man (played by Suresh Gopi), and they have a child together. Tragedy strikes when Suresh Gopi's character is murdered, and Mohan becomes the prime suspect in the eyes of the community. The film unfolds as a drama exploring themes of love, jealousy, and the quest for justice.
